Whitchurch Town Council is extremely pleased to announce that free organic compost will be made available from outside the Winchester Road allotment site in November.
Following the successful allotment competition organised by the Town Council this year,our main sponsor Jody Scheckter of Laverstoke Park Farm, has kindly offered to supply 20 cubic metres (a large lorry load!) of organic compost which is made at his farm in Overton.
He is supplying the compost free of charge to allotment holders and gardeners in Whitchurch on a first come,first served basis. The haulier is also waiving his charge so this really is a free offer.
The compost will arrive on Friday 9th November and be delivered adjacent to the Winchester Road allotment site. Just bring your bags or sacks and fill up.
The high quality compost will considerably improve the quality of the soil and in turn,improve the quality and quantity of vegetables grown on the allotment site or in your garden at home.
